Re: CC in Hershey park??
I've carried at Hershey. You want to conceal well since if your firearm is spotted, they will escort you out. That means no printing.
Also, be aware of your firearm when on the rides....especially the more intense ones. I did read of a legal carrier losing his handgun when a ride inverted (guess it must have been a roller coaster).
